Default Fax Blocked

I'm having trouble sending (and, I suspect without good evidence,
receiving) faxes from my WindowsXP Pro machine. Sending a fax adds
*two* entries to the "Pending" jobs in the Fax printer queue in
Printers, but the Fax Console does not detect them; they don't show up
in either the Outbox or the Sent Items folder (and they don't get
sent).

I've removed Fax from the Windows Components and reinstalled it from
the CD to no avail. I'm unable to find anything in either the printer
configuration or the Fax Console that would indicate the source of the
problem; Help is uninformative, as the troubleshooter doesn't seem to
include this particular symptom. The Modem is functional for dialup to
TCP/IP and its configuration also looks normal.

Where can I look for more info, and what might anyone suggest to
remove the blockage and get faxes moving?

John, I had exactly the same problem and it was related to the TEMP folder
missing. You didn't happen to delete it from 'Documents and
settings/username/local settings/temp' by some chance?
I had a more involved problem since the default system temp environment
variable was somehow changed. BTW, reinstalling SP2 will restore any missing
Temp folder.
